RIP(Routing Information Protocol)是一种距离向量路由协议,它使用路由距离作为其路由算法,并通过路由表信息交换来确定到达网络的最佳路径。 RIP是一种老式的路由协议,在现代网络环境下,其效率和可靠性都受到一定的限制。本文将从多个角度,进行分析 RIP路由协议使用的路由算法是什么。
1. RIP路由算法
RIP路由算法使用基于距离向量的路由选择算法,其路由表存储了到达各个网络的距离。 RIP路由协议中路由器之间周期性地交换路由表信息(一般是每隔30秒),从而在整个网络中建立起路由表和拓扑图,并更新其中路由的状态。
RIP路由算法是基于贝尔曼-福德算法的一种实现,它使用了距离作为其路由计算的依据。根据 RIP路由算法的计算规则,它将选择距离最近的网络作为最佳路径,并添加到路由表中。 RIP路由算法的最大距离限制为15跳,这意味着当某个网络的距离超过15个路由器时,此网络就被认为是不可达的。另外, RIP路由协议还支持负载平衡,它可以将流量分配到多条等距离的路径上。
2. RIP路由协议的特点
RIP路由协议具有以下几个特点:
(1)开销较小: RIP路由协议的路由表信息量较小,且可靠性较高。
(2)局限性较大: RIP路由协议的最大距离限制为15跳,并且不支持虚拟专用网(VPN),这使得 RIP路由协议适用范围较窄。
(3)处理速度较慢: RIP路由协议采用周期交换路由表信息的方式,因此它的处理速度比较慢,可能会导致延迟和数据包损失。
(4)易于配置: RIP路由协议的配置比较简单,容易实现和管理。
3. RIP路由协议的缺点
RIP路由协议具有以下几个缺点:
(1)可靠性较低: RIP路由协议的路由计算方式并不是完全准确的,可能会导致路由循环和黑洞现象的出现。
(2)收敛时间较慢: RIP路由协议的收敛时间较长,可能需要几分钟甚至数小时才能使路由器的路由计算达到稳定状态。
(3)不支持多种网络协议: RIP路由协议仅支持IP协议,不支持其他网络协议。
4. 总结
RIP路由协议使用的路由算法是基于距离向量的路由选择算法,它采用了贝尔曼-福德算法实现,并使用距离作为其路由计算的依据。 RIP路由协议具有开销较小、易于配置等特点,但也有局限性较大、处理速度较慢等缺点。因此,在现代网络环境下,RIP路由协议已经不太适用,更为先进的路由协议已经取代了它的地位。
扫码咨询 领取资料